Provenance — Larkspell request tracing. Every cross-service call in the Dunmore mesh carries a propagated trace context; builds of the tracing sidecar are attested at release. Contractors: verify the sidecar version matches the attested manifest before debugging span gaps. Do not trust unattested sidecars. The current attested release carries this token.

session token of bawep-yadup = htk21_528abd376e3c5a4ec24a1

Provenance for GridLoom, our crossword generator, is straightforward: all builds come from the Thistledown runner, never from laptops. As a new contractor, please verify that any artifact you test matches the signed manifest before installing it. Unsigned builds should be reported and discarded immediately. Each legitimate build is stamped with a short provenance token, reproduced below.

pipeline stamp: htk9_ce63042d9

Handover: Quillbeam firmware channel

Passing the baton to you, Marit's off this week. The Quillbeam device fleet moved from the "stable" to the "gradual" update channel on Tuesday, so support may see devices on mixed firmware versions for a few days — that's expected, not a bug. Rollout caps at 10% per day and pauses automatically if crash rates spike. If a customer insists on pinning a version, point them at the channel override doc. Current channel configuration follows for reference.

deployment values, bahof-badug:
[rusix]
team = zorok
access_code = ac_641cbe
owner = ulair.tamius
host = rusix.torvasoft.local
port = 5672
peer = ulaix.sivrelworks.internal
salt = 1df570ed
pin = 6327

**Ticket PKT-88: Webhook fires twice on parcel handoff**

For whoever inherits this: the Cartwheel parcel-tracking webhook double-fires when a package moves from the Delven hub to a courier within the same minute. Downstream, Merrow's notifier then texts customers twice. Root cause looks like a missing idempotency check in the handoff event coalescer. Repro steps attached. The offending deploy is identified by the token below.

trace token, hawep-hadug: htk3_9c2